Transaction e8c62597a73f1f10137565000650dcf47b03f09c98bef8a35c282e966215fe62
1 Input
1 Output
-
e8c62597a73f1f10137565000650dcf47b03f09c98bef8a35c282e966215fe62:0
- value
- 6461600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dba7c59c1551056d5ec7e27f7bd9fc8680052fda O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M2Ry1T1K7tH8mqfuRHJA16zRJAduv8YqD